Summary
My name is Winette Moriarty, I am a time traveler and a professional missionary.
I live near a church in the suburbs of London. I am good at fortune-telling and unmarried. My hobby is peeling oranges. My favorite book is Mrs. Beeton's "Orange Marmalade Recipe" and my favorite music is "LILIUM". I listen to the confessions of believers every day and kindly guide them to "bloodless" solutions.
Before going to bed, I always eat a bottle of orange marmalade, then practice Bajiquan for half an hour, and occasionally spar with the wanted criminals in the neighborhood, but that’s it. I have a regular life and am a typical beautiful girl, but the doctor said my blood sugar is slightly above the standard.
Although I love peace and am committed to human harmony, there are always mafia, thugs, and wanted criminals hanging around my house, then kneeling down at my adoptive father's feet, crying bitterly, and devoutly calling him "Godfather."
Until one night, a woman in black who called herself "Vermouth" came to me and said that my adoptive father had died unexpectedly and wanted me to join a mysterious organization...
So, I came to the international crime city of Beika-cho...
------
(Conan fan fiction, the protagonist is Shinobi, written by Juzi.)
